A new method of factor analysis has been devised as a dynamic study in nuclear medicine. Instead of whole sequence factor analysis of images, partially-sequenced images of Kr-81m pulmonary ventilation scintigrams, acquired with respiratory-gated signals, were analysed using this method. Incrementing the first and last frame number of the image sequence, the motion of the factor images, was obtained including diaphragmatic images, thoracic images and physiological pathological dead space, during one respiratory cycle. The varying form of the correlation between two factor images over time provided a distinguishable pattern of patients with pathological conditions such as chronic obstructive pulmonary disese from normal subjects.
